If the Sensex goes up, it means that the prices of the stocks of most of the companies under the BSE (Bombay Stock Exchange) Sensex (30 companies) have gone up. If the Sensex goes down, this tells you that the stock price of most of the major stocks on the BSE have gone down. Simlpe! :)
A relationship between SENSEX and Reliance is called BETA. The BETA of Reliance Industries is 1.12 for the 365 days trading. If SENSEX move up by 1% the RIL will move up by 1.12%.

SENSEX MEANS SENSITIVE INDEX.
Sensex stands Bombay Exchange Sensitive Index. It gives an indicator whether stocks have gone up or gone down in all the major companies of the BSE.
Sensex term was coined by Deepak Mohoni
Securities & Exchanges Board of India - SEBI regulates the Sensex

Top 30 Companies with highest market capitalization, are taken into consideration for calculation of BSE SENSEX. SENSEX is an index of 30 companies listed on the Bombay Stock Exchange. SENSEX has been the main measure of the health of the Indiana stock market.
